Let me tell you about the role

Provides business support to users of HSE&C systems such as IRIS, DPM, LENS, PMCS, Power BI and PIMs. Involved in maintaining and enhancing all aspects of the system application including, validation and testing of system enhancements and updating and managing system user access requirements. This role will work closely with the business and digital teams to address ServiceNow tickets received. This role will also provide insights and analytics on HSE&C data and any trends observed.

What you will deliver

  • Track and trend data to inform critical decisions on management of safety across projects and allows leadership to be fully informed when making these decisions

  • Responsible for daily maintenance of HSE&C performance trends reporting and dashboards; Compiled performance data from IRIS, PMCS and DPM into a database and transfer into PowerBI interactive dashboards

  • Maintain Leading Indicator Metrics reporting and dashboards – update and refresh the Projects Leading Indicator Metrics data reporting dashboards in PowerBI

  • Deliver / support requests of dashboards / data analysis, trends and insights to support leadership meetings (SORCs; performance reviews; safety leadership calls; safety communication)

  • Support weekly performance analysis HSE&C Reporting and weekly reviews of incidents to ensure accurate and complete reporting by all projects; maintained performance and incident summaries; prepare weekly/monthly performance and leadership reports; tracked Tier 1 and Tier 2 process safety events for projects following their first two years of production; and assembled QPR/OPR data for Finance

  • Coordination of processes for system user access management and maintenance of role mapping matrices for new projects to IRIS

  • Support validation and testing for processed system defect fixes and enhancements prior to release to system production environments

  • Manage daily triage of IRIS tickets and ensure all incoming support requests received within ServiceNow ticketing system are categorized appropriately and allocated to the right work-stream, obtaining any further information or analysis as required to enable classification

  • Execute resolution of system related business support tickets within acceptable timelines, ensuring that the true nature of the problem is understood and involving technical and discipline expertise as required

  • Responsible for master data maintenance, working with the Product Advisors and Systems & Tools Lead to apply the appropriate levels of governance and MoC, prior to implementation

  • Coordination and execution of systems related communications and facilitation and maintenance of the communication channels and processes associated with the Community of Practice

  • Maintenance of training support material, including quick reference guides, reference documents and master data reports

  • Coordination of processes for system user access management and maintenance of role mapping matrices

  • Support validation and testing for processed system defect fixes and enhancements prior to release to system production environments

  • Focus on user experience improvement and delivering efficient and effective service management

  • Deliver progress updates, relevant change management information, and system training via Community of Practice calls or other training sessions.
